Title :
Elevation dependence of building penetration loss for satellite services at 3.5 GHz and 5.0 GHz

Abstract :
Based on experimental results obtained during an extensive measurement campaign aimed at building penetration loss for satellite services, an elevation dependence of penetration loss is discussed in this paper. For the analysis, three different types of typical buildings in an urban area were selected. These case-study buildings are compared here by addressing the trend and absolute values of the corresponding elevation-dependent penetration loss with respect to the particular measurement scenario as well as their respective structures and building material.
